CBRE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2023 in Review

695 of the 6,301 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in CBRE Group (CBRE) for Q3 2023, worth a combined $22B — down 11% from $24.6B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 65 funds closed out of CBRE and 61 opened new positions — a net loss of 4 holders — while 281 trimmed existing stakes and 233 added.

The largest buyer was Farallon Capital Management, opening a new position worth an estimated $375M. The largest seller was ValueAct Holdings, cutting an estimated $381M.
